The cheapest way to get from Hakata Port International Terminal to Tokyo is to fly and train which costs ¥8500 - ¥24000 and takes 4h 31m.
The fastest way to get from Hakata Port International Terminal to Tokyo is to fly which takes 3h 37m and costs ¥12000 - ¥30000.
Yes, there is an overnight bus departing from Nishitetsu Tenjin Bus Terminal and arriving at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al. This bus operates every day. The journey takes approximately 14h 36m.
No, there is no direct train from Hakata Port International Terminal to Tokyo station. However, there are services departing from Nakasu-Kawabata and arriving at Tōkyō Station via Hakata Fukuoka.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 47m.
The distance between Hakata Port International Terminal and Tokyo is 911 km. The road distance is 1074.6 km.
